During My Hero Academia chapter 357, a strong and emotional moment for Endeavoras he started his fierce comeback against All For One and is pushing his body at a reckless pace as his flames burn him to a heat never seen before and has made him think about what could happen after the fight is over, he wants take down All For One by any means, even if it costs him his life, and set out to leave the best possible future for his son and the other students.
So at that point Endeavor imagines what that would look like, and fans can see the back of an adult Shoto walking towards the others and each one of them looks a bit taller than they are now, so we’re led to believe. that this might not be so far in the future, but rather just a year or two ahead in history.
